Consistent Patterns. Every Pallet.
Dry goods lines often run multiple carton sizes and SKUs through the same end-of-line system — and each configuration requires a different pallet pattern to ensure stability during transport. Manual palletizing handles pattern changes informally, which means pattern quality varies by operator and shift. The result is inconsistent pallet stability and increased product damage in transit.
ESC integrates robotic palletizing systems with programmable pattern libraries that produce the same tight, stable pallet every time — regardless of carton size, weight, or SKU. Pattern changes are made from the touchscreen with no mechanical retooling. Our systems are engineered for the dry goods formats your line runs, with infeed conveyor and pallet handling included as part of the complete system.

Two Robots. Double the Output.
High-throughput dry goods lines — cereals, grains, powders, and packaged staples — often produce cases faster than a single palletizer can stack them. When the palletizer becomes the bottleneck at end of line, the upstream production rate is limited by the slowest step in the sequence rather than the capacity of the filler or former.
ESC integrates dual-robot palletizing cells with comb and plate grippers that pick and place full case layers simultaneously — doubling effective palletizing output within the same cell footprint. Our dual-robot configurations are engineered as a single system with shared controls, synchronized infeed, and alternating pallet positions so both robots run continuously without waiting on each other or on the operator.
